OPPE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2017 in Review
41 of the 4,017 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in WisdomTree European Opportunities Fund (OPPE) for Q1 2017, worth a combined $82.3M — down 21% from $105M a quarter earlier.
Buyers outnumbered sellers: 5 funds opened new OPPE positions and 2 closed out — a net gain of 3 holders — while 10 added to existing stakes and 14 trimmed.
The largest buyer was Jane Street, adding an estimated $3.5M. The largest seller was UBS AM, cutting an estimated $19.3M.
